Malcolm has $638.54 in his checking account. He must maintain a $500 balance to avoid a fee. He wrote a check for $159.50 today.

Write an inequality that would be used to solve for the least amount of money he needs to deposit to avoid a fee.
638.54 +159.50 − x ≥ 500
638.54 + 159.50 − x ≤ 500
638.54 − 159.50 + x ≥ 500
638.54 − 159.50 + x ≤ 500

Answer:

638.54-159.50+×> 500

Choose 3

Step-by-step explanation:

638.54-159.50=488.04

So the number added must make the value greater or equal to 500
